What Are Off-Road Accessories?
Off-road accessories describe the wide variety of aftermarket parts and equipment created to improve the durability, capability, and security of vehicles operating in off-highway settings. In Idaho, these accessories are particularly crucial as a result of uncertain surface and remote travel problems.
Usual groups include:
1. Suspension and Raise Sets
Upgraded suspension systems and lift sets boost ground clearance, allowing lorries to navigate rocks, logs, and irregular terrain without damages. In Idaho’s hilly trails, this is usually the initial adjustment lovers make.
2. Tires and Tires
All-terrain (AT) and mud-terrain (MT) tires are crucial for grip in differing problems. Enhanced sidewalls help stop leaks on sharp rocks generally located in Idaho’s backcountry.
3. Recuperation Gear
Winches, tow straps, recovery boards, and D-rings are essential for scenarios where automobiles come to be stuck. Remote Idaho trails usually do not have cell solution, making self-recovery tools essential.
4. Lighting Equipments
LED light bars and supporting fog lights boost visibility throughout morning or nighttime driving, which is common throughout long overland explorations.
5. Armor and Defense
Skid plates, rock sliders, and bumper supports shield lorries from damages triggered by harsh surface. In rocky regions of Idaho, undercarriage security is specifically important.
6. Navigation and Communication Tools
General practitioner systems, satellite communicators, and radio devices make certain travelers can browse remote areas securely. Several locations in Idaho have no reputable cellular protection.

The Duty of Accessories in Safety and Survival
Among one of the most vital elements of off-road devices in Idaho is safety. Remote tracks can be hours and even days away from emergency situation solutions. Harsh climate condition, sudden surface modifications, and mechanical failures can swiftly come to be unsafe.
Devices such as emergency situation communication gadgets, first-aid kits, and portable air compressors are not simply comforts– they are critical survival tools. Winches and grip boards can indicate the difference between self-recovery and being stranded overnight in freezing hill conditions.
Furthermore, car armor helps stop expensive or harmful mechanical failures. A broken oil pan or pierced tire in a remote canyon can escalate into a lethal scenario without appropriate equipment.
